Instructions. preheat your oven to 375°f. grease an 8×8 pan and set aside. mix together the butter, sour cream and add sugar. add in the eggs, beating in completely. stir in the box of jiffy mix. mix now until the ingredients are completely incorporated. spread the mixture out in the pan in an even layer. Instructions. preheat the oven to 450 degrees. grease a 9 inch baking pan or cast iron skillet with butter or oil. add the butter, milk, sour cream, honey, and eggs to a large mixing bowl and mix with a spatula until combined. add in the jiffy mix and mix until there are no lumps left. let the batter sit at room temperature for 20 minutes.
